Potential Hazards and Risks

Blowing up a pipeline can have catastrophic consequences. Some of the major hazards and risks include:

1. Loss of human lives: Explosions can cause significant harm to nearby individuals, construction workers, and emergency response teams, posing a grave risk to human life.

2. Environmental damage: Pipelines transport various substances, such as oil and gas, that can be highly toxic to the environment. Blowing up a pipeline can lead to pollution of natural resources, including soil, water bodies, and surrounding ecosystems.

3. Infrastructure destruction: Pipeline explosions can cause extensive damage to nearby buildings, roads, bridges, and other critical infrastructure. This destruction can disrupt essential services and impose significant financial burdens on both individuals and communities.

4. Legal consequences: Engaging in such activities is a serious violation of the law and can result in severe penalties, including imprisonment and hefty fines.

In conclusion, How to Blow Up a Pipeline by Andreas Malm is a thought-provoking article that presents a radical perspective on climate change activism. Malm argues that conventional methods of peaceful protest, such as marches and sit-ins, are insufficient for the urgent task of addressing the climate crisis. Instead, he proposes that sabotage and property destruction, specifically targeting fossil fuel infrastructure, can be strategic and effective tools in forcing systemic change.

While Malm’s stance may be perceived as extreme or controversial, it nevertheless compels readers to critically examine the urgency of the climate crisis and the inadequacy of current efforts. The author emphasizes the need for immediate and disruptive action, highlighting the urgent need to shift the global energy paradigm away from destructive fossil fuels.

However, it is essential to acknowledge that this article is not advocating for violence or endorsing illegal activities. Malm emphasizes the importance of non-lethal sabotage, aiming to disrupt the functioning of pipelines without causing harm to individuals. Nevertheless, the implications of such actions raise ethical and legal concerns, as well as the potential for unintended consequences or counterproductive outcomes.

Ultimately, How to Blow Up a Pipeline challenges readers to reassess the limits of conventional activism and to consider radical alternatives in the face of an existential threat. While not a mainstream or widely accepted approach, the article serves as a catalyst for dialogue on the urgency of climate action and the need for transformative solutions.
